How do I open a PowerPoint presentation in Keynote on iPad?

To open a different file type, such as a Microsoft PowerPoint file, in Keynote on iPhone or iPad, tap the file in the presentation manager. If you can’t see the presentation manager, tap Presentations (on an iPad) or the back button (on an iPhone), then tap the file you want to open.

How do I convert a Keynote presentation to PowerPoint?

How to convert Keynote to PowerPoint

  1. Launch Keynote and open your presentation.
  2. To convert to PowerPoint, click File in the app’s top menu bar.
  3. Select Export To then PowerPoint.
  4. Click Next.
  5. Edit the name of your file in the Save As section, if needed.
  6. Choose where to save your file in the Where section.
  7. Click Export.

How do I convert PowerPoint to notes?

How To Save Powerpoint as PDF With Notes Included

  1. Open your PowerPoint presentation.
  2. Click “File,” then “Print.”
  3. Go to the “Show Details” section.
  4. Choose “Notes” from the “Layout” dropdown.
  5. Choose “Save as PDF” from the “PDF” dropdown, and click “Save.”

How do I put PowerPoint presentations together in Keynote?

Group slides

  1. In the slide navigator, click to select a slide or select multiple slides you want to group below the slide above.
  2. Drag the slides to the right until a line appears on the left. Slides can be indented up to six levels deep, but you can indent only one level between consecutive slides.

How do I insert a slide from one Keynote presentation to another?

Insert a slide from another presentation

  1. Open two presentations.
  2. In the slide navigator, click to select a slide or select multiple slides of one presentation, then drag them to the slide navigator of the other presentation.

How do I open a Microsoft PowerPoint file in keynote?

To open a file like a Microsoft PowerPoint file in Keynote on iPhone or iPad, tap the file in the presentation manager. If you don’t see the presentation manager, tap Presentations (on an iPad) or the back button (on an iPhone), then tap the file that you want to open. If a file is dimmed, it’s not in a compatible format.

What is the format of keynote presentation documents?

Keynote presentation documents are saved as Keynote format files with “.key” file extensions. Keynote is an Apple program and therefore only available for Apple Mac and iDevices only, there is no Windows version.

How do I edit a keynote presentation that I received?

If you received a Keynote presentation but don’t have a Mac iPad with Keynote installed, ask the person who sent the Keynote slides (or anybody who has the app) to save the Keynote file as a PowerPoint presentation. After this, he or she sends the ppt or pptx file, and you open and edit it on your Windows computer.
